Mass Effect 2 - No More Elevators

by Skavenhorde, 2009-12-07 09:20:09

Kotaku reports that Bioware has officially dumped the elevators transition system in favor of loading screens. It seems that Bioware recieved a lot of grief over these infernal contraptions. Ray Muzyka said back in April that there would be a completely new system to handle transitions into other areas in Mass Effect 2 and now Thomas R. Roy said this:

The elevators were made in ME1 so we didn't have to show boring loading screens. However there were a lot of complaints, so we've gone back to loading screens and movies. We still have elevators in ME2, but you don't wait inside them. We'll cut to a loading screen instead. [emphasis added]

We've tried to make the loading screen more interesting this time by adding interesting visuals and information.

The elevator conversations had some funny moments, but hopefully people will enjoy this new system better than the old one!
